  7. @GossiTheDog @scrumwhat like all complex matters its quite easy for us (#security) people to blame #compliance for all that is evil in the world. Don’t do that, all that I know are decent people with a very difficult job. It’s easy to forget that compliance = «reasonable assurance» and has never ever meant as a replacement for proper #systemSecureEngineering. Me coming from #military #classified world where #systemsecurity is one of the key cornerstones, can tell you that this requires #focus, #competences (people process and tools) #resourceAllocation well beyond what is common in commercial companies today. Now we are in the territory of #strategy and for most companies #reasonableAssurance is seen as good enough. #EU regulation like #NIS2 might change the equation here for some….
